Nov 24 2018 Anchor

good news just got dcg 5.0 working with Steam AS2 3.262.0, I had to reinstall the C++ distribution package I loaded both 32 and 64 bit versions. vcredist from microsoft after several restarts it worked.

bad news is that the inventory bug for vehicles still exists, pz4G keeps inventory and pz4H resets. I am still looking for the def files even in AS2 DCG 5.0, campaign resource entity vehicle directory doesn't exist, any ideas? Did you guys hide them somewhere else?

Nov 24 2018 Anchor

Well, since the AS2 version doesnt have any new (ie made by us) vehicles added, we dont need to add those folders into the mod, in other words, DCG for AS2 uses vanilla values for all vehicles, and thus, you will find these .def files in the standard game folders.

However, if you want to change .def's, just create these folders yourself, for the IS3, you should create a campaign/resource/entity/-vehicle/tank_heavy folder, and inside this folder, you copy-paste the IS3 folder, then open the folder, and delete everything except for the .def file (you only need this one, unless you want to change stuff in the .mdl file as well).

The above has to be done for all vehicles you want to change basic ammo loadout, guns etc for. And the folders has to be named the same as in vanilla game.

Nov 25 2018 Anchor

Thanks Zeke

I checked the resource folders for AS2 AS1 and MOW basic vanilla game, AS1 from Amazon Dl, MOW from GOG.com dl, and AS2 from Steam dl. None of them have a vehicle folder in vanilla game install there are "pak" files one of them is huge, I suspect the game at launch extracts the def files as needed. How do you guys get at them?

Thanks

Mike

Nov 25 2018 Anchor

You open .paks with either WinRar or 7zip. The first is a pay-to-use software, the latter is a free (and a much better) archiver.
